Higher Florida Minimum Wage Starting in January 2017

nickel-picture On January 1, 2017, the Florida minimum wage will increase by five cents ($0.05) from $8.05 to $8.10 per hour.  A covered employee who is paid the minimum wage would also be entitled to an overtime wage of at least $12.15 per hour.  As of January 1, 2017, tipped employees in Florida must be paid a direct wage of $5.08, which is equal to the $8.10 minimum wage minus a $3.02 tip credit, and an overtime wage of $9.13.  An employee who has not received the required wage may bring a lawsuit in court.  If your employer or former employer fails to pay you the required wage rate, call a wage attorney at Bober & Bober, P.A. at 800-995-9243 for a free consultation.
